FT Reports That India Will Double Diplomatic Corps
The Indian Ministry of External Affairs announced that it plans to double its diplomatic corps within the next five years, reports Jo Johnson of the Financial Times. During a decade in which India joined 13 multilateral organizations and saw its foreign trade surge seven-fold, the number of staff working for the ministry of external affairs decreased from 4,866 to 4,746. In order to address its shortage of personnel, the ministry has already begun filling its ranks with a generation of young strategists who have recast foreign policy for the post-cold war era.
